Christmas Do-Over is a 2006 Christmas television film starring Jay Mohr and Daphne Zuniga. [2] It premiered on ABC Family in 2006 on their 25 Days of Christmas programming block. It is a remake of a previous 1996 television film, Christmas Every Day , but with an adult as the protagonist. Groundhog Day is a 1993 American fantasy comedy film directed by Harold Ramis from a screenplay by him and Danny Rubin.Starring Bill Murray, Andie MacDowell, and Chris Elliott, it tells the story of a cynical television weatherman covering the annual Groundhog Day event in Punxsutawney, Pennsylvania, who becomes trapped in a time loop, forcing him to relive February 2 repeatedly.
